UFC NEWS – UFC 143's Fabricio Werdum Looking To Finish Roy Nelson


“There’s no easy fight anymore. Everybody knows a little bit of everything: Jiu-Jitsu, Wrestling, Boxing, and Muay Thai. It’s a different time we’re living in. Nelson knocked Cro Cop out, he has a very strong right hand, sharp Boxing, but I’ll impose my rhythm and play by my game plan until I tire him out. Knocking out or submitting, I want to make it a good show. I analyzed Nelson when I signed with UFC; I watched his fights and observed his stand-up. He’s a heavy guy, so I’m excited about fighting guys like him and I’m training with guys like him on top of me so I get used to it. I’ll impose my rhythm. It’s hard to knock him out, but anything can happen. If I find a loop, I’ll try to finish him. I was watching Rodrigo Nogueira VS. Frank Mir and I’ve learned that, when the opportunity presents itself, you gotta knockout or submit. The important thing is to have your arm raised at the end of the fight.”

Newly signed UFC heavyweight fighter, Fabricio Werdum, tells Brazilian media outlet, Tatame.com that he plans on finishing Roy Nelson in their UFC 143 clash of heavyweights.

Returning to the UFC for the first time since his knockout loss to Junior Dos Santos, a win over Roy Nelson would prove to his doubters that he belongs in discussion amongst the world’s best.

After a Strikeforce stint that saw him dethrone “The Last Emperor” and take out a “Bigfoot” Werdum is now back on the big stage as one of the latest Strikeforce stars acquired by the UFC post ZUFFA acquisition.

Will he be able to do as he says and take it to “The Ultimate Fighter” winner or will he fail at making an impact in his return to the Octagon?
